[Ohrrpgce] SVN: teeemcee/8121 Improve script profiling: track time spent in children (childtime).

subversion at HamsterRepublic.com subversion at HamsterRepublic.com
Thu Sep 1 11:03:26 PDT 2016


teeemcee
2016-09-01 11:03:25 -0700 (Thu, 01 Sep 2016)
480
Improve script profiling: track time spent in children (childtime).

Also, in g_debug.txt print a second table of scripts sorted by childtime,
and improve the help message.

Factored out all profiling stuff to the *_timing functions in
scripting.bas (as part of move to new interpreter).

You can call stop_fibre_timing and start_fibre_timing to pause
timing; scripterr and script_interrupt now do this to avoid
mucking up the times. killallscripts now also properly stops timing.
---
U   wip/config.bi
U   wip/game.bas
U   wip/gglobals.bi
U   wip/oldhsinterpreter.bas
U   wip/scripting.bas
U   wip/scripting.bi
U   wip/udts.bi


More information about the Ohrrpgce mailing list